A Cylindrical, Inner Volume Selecting 2D-T(2)-Prep Improves GRAPPA-Accelerated Image Quality in MRA of the Right Coronary Artery
BACKGROUND: Two-dimensional (2D) spatially selective radiofrequency (RF) pulses may be used to excite restricted volumes. By incorporating a "pencil beam" 2D pulse into a T(2)-Prep, one may create a "2D-T(2)-Prep" that combines T(2)-weighting with an intrinsic outer volume suppre...
